The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the Thames Valley with a requirement for REST sk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ited REST over the 6 months to 1 June 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
1 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 181 107 130
Rank change year-on-year -74 +23 -65
Permanent jobs citing REST 71 163 182
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the Thames Valley 1.00% 2.86% 2.49%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 5.98% 10.12% 7.31%
Number of salaries quoted 37 67 126
10th Percentile £47,750 £47,300 £35,000
25th Percentile £51,250 £53,750 £47,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£62,500 £69,000 £65,000
Median % change year-on-year -9.42% +6.15% +18.18%
75th Percentile £80,000 £73,125 £78,438
90th Percentile £83,750 £98,500 £85,000
South East median annual salary £57,500 £55,690 £60,000
% change year-on-year +3.25% -7.18% +14.29%
